Double Pane Window Repair: A Comprehensive Guide
Double pane windows, also referred to as insulated glass units (IGUs), are a popular choice for homes due to their remarkable insulation and energy efficiency. These windows consist of 2 glass panes separated by a layer of air or gas, which helps to minimize heat transfer and noise. Nevertheless, over time, these windows can establish problems such as fogging, condensation, and damaged seals, demanding repair. This post provides a comprehensive guide to double pane window repair, including typical problems, DIY services, and professional repair options.
Common Problems with Double Pane Windows
Before diving into the repair procedure, it's necessary to comprehend the common problems that can impact double pane windows:

Fogging and Condensation:
Cause: Fogging occurs when the seal in between the two panes of glass breaks, permitting moisture to get in the air gap. This is typically the first indication that the window needs repair.Symptoms: Visible fog or condensation between the glass panes, especially during temperature level changes.
Broken Seals:
Cause: The seal in between the panes can deteriorate due to age, direct exposure to severe temperature levels, or physical damage.Symptoms: Drafts, increased energy expenses, and lowered insulation effectiveness.
Split or Broken Glass:
Cause: Impact from items, severe weather, or structural problems.Symptoms: Visible cracks or shattered glass.
Leaking Air or Gas:
Cause: The seal might enable air or gas to get away, decreasing the window's insulating homes.Symptoms: Drafts and increased energy consumption.Do It Yourself Solutions for Minor Issues

While some minor issues can be addressed with DIY options, more serious problems typically need professional intervention. Here are some situations where it's best to contact a specialist:

Replacing Glass Panes:
Why: If one or both panes of glass are split or broken, it's more secure and more efficient to have an expert replace the glass.Process: A professional will remove the harmed window, clean the frame, and install brand-new glass panes with a fresh seal.
Reconditioning the Window:
Why: For misted or leaking windows, reconditioning includes eliminating the old glass, drying the frame, and reapplying a new seal.Process: This is an intricate job that needs specific devices and competence to ensure the window is correctly sealed and reassembled.
Energy Efficiency Upgrades:
Why: If your window is old or inefficient, an expert can assist with upgrades such as replacing the glass with a more energy-efficient alternative or including extra insulation.Process: A specialist will assess the window, recommend the finest upgrade alternatives, and carry out the essential work to improve energy performance.Expert Repair Services

Q: How do I know if my double pane window needs repair?
A: Common signs include fogging, condensation, drafts, and increased energy costs. If you observe any of these concerns, it's an excellent concept to have the window checked.
Q: Can I fix a foggy double pane window myself?
A: While you can try cleaning up the interior surfaces, the most efficient solution is to have the window reconditioned or replaced by an expert.
Q: How much does double pane window repair cost?
A: The expense varies depending on the level of the damage and the size of the window. Minor repairs like seal replacement can cost a few hundred dollars, while complete window replacement can be more pricey.
Q: Is it much better to repair or replace a double pane window?
A: If the damage is small and the window is relatively new, repair is often adequate. Nevertheless, if the window is old or extensively damaged, replacement may be more economical and offer better energy performance.
Q: How long does a double pane window repair take?

To extend the life of your double pane windows and avoid future concerns, consider the following maintenance tips:

Regular Cleaning:
Why: Dust and particles can accumulate on the window and affect its performance.How: Clean the outside and interior surfaces of the window with a moderate detergent and water. Use a soft fabric or sponge to prevent scratching the glass.
Inspect for Damage:
Why: Early detection of damage can avoid more serious issues.How: Check the window for cracks, drafts, and misting a minimum of once a year. Pay special attention to the seals around the edges.
Correct Ventilation:
Why: High humidity levels can cause condensation and fogging.How: Ensure your home is well-ventilated, specifically in locations prone to high humidity such as kitchen areas and bathrooms.
Prevent Harsh Chemicals:
Why: Harsh chemicals can harm the seals and the glass.How: Use just moderate, non-abrasive cleaners on your windows. Avoid utilizing bleach or other strong solvents.
Professional Inspections:
Why: Regular assessments by a specialist can recognize possible issues before they become significant issues.How: Schedule an expert evaluation every couple of years, particularly if you observe any modifications in the window's efficiency.
